schtasks 运行

立即启动计划任务。 运行操作将忽略计划,但使用任务中保存的程序文件位置、用户帐户和密码来立即运行任务。 运行任务不会影响任务计划,也不会更改为任务计划的下一个运行时间。

语法

schtasks /run /tn <taskname> [/s <computer> [/u [<domain>\]<user> [/p <password>]]]

参数

参数 说明
/tn <taskname> 标识要启动的任务。 此参数是必需的。
/s <computer> 指定远程计算机的名称或 IP 地址 (有或不包含反斜杠) 。 默认为本地计算机。
/u [<domain>] 用指定用户帐户的权限运行此命令。 默认情况下,使用本地计算机当前用户的权限运行命令。 指定的用户帐户必须是远程计算机上 Administrators 组的成员。 /U/p参数仅在使用/s时有效。
/p <password> 指定在 /u 参数中指定的用户帐户的密码。 如果在不使用/p参数或 password 参数的情况下使用/u参数,则 schtasks 将提示你输入密码。 /U/p参数仅在使用/s时有效。
/? 在命令提示符下显示帮助。

注解

  • 使用此操作来测试您的任务。 如果任务不运行,请检查任务计划程序服务事务日志中 <Systemroot>\SchedLgU.txt 是否有错误。

  • 若要远程运行任务,则必须在远程计算机上计划任务。 当你运行任务时,它仅在远程计算机上运行。 若要验证某一任务是否正在远程计算机上运行,请使用任务管理器或任务计划程序服务事务日志 <Systemroot>\SchedLgU.txt

示例

若要启动 安全脚本 任务,请键入:

schtasks /run /tn Security Script

若要在远程计算机上启动 更新 任务,请在 Svr01 中键入:

schtasks /run /tn Update /s Svr01

其他参考